Features Dened
1 LCD Display View the Time, PM Indicator, iPod Indicator, Aux Input Indicator, AV Input Indicator, EQ
Mode, and Radio Frequency through this Liquid Crystal Display.
2 AV Inputs 1-4 Connect an audio or audio/video source, such as a CD or DVD player, to one of these four
inputs. Note that inputs 3 and 4 are paired with AV3 S-Video and AV4 S-Video inputs. The S-Video Inputs
provide improved picture quality.
3 RESET Press the RESET button using a paperclip or like object to restore factory default settings on the
unit.
4 Mini-USB Use this mini-USB port to connect the unit to a computer and sync your iPod directly from the
player’s docking station.
5 Sync / Play When the included USB cord is connected, use this toggle switch to change control between the
unit and a computer.
6 Video Out Plug the yellow connector of an AV Cord in the Video Output to send a video signal from an iPod
to a display with a composite video input.
7 Subwoofer Output Use the SW Line-out to connect the unit to an external Subwoofer.
8 S-Video Output Connect your display via the S-Video Output for improved picture quality.
9 PLAY/PAUSE Press the PLAY/PAUSE button to play or pause an iPod.
10 POWER Press the POWER button to turn the unit on or off.
11 VOLUME Press the (+) button to increase the volume and the (-) button to decrease the volume.
12 OPEN/CLOSE Press the OPEN/CLOSE button to extend and retract the motorized iPod dock.
13 TUNING Press the (+) and (-) buttons to cycle through different radio frequencies.
14 FUNCTION Press the F button to switch between iPod, radio, AUX (AUX In), iPod 2 (iPod Shufe port),
AV1, AV2, AV3, or AV4 control.
15 iPod Shufe Use the iPod shufe port to connect a rst generation iPod shufe to the player.
16 Headphone Jack Use the Headphone Jack to plug in a set of headphones (not included).
17 iPod Motorized Docking Station Select the correct insert and connect your iPod, iPod mini, or iPod nano.
18 FM Antenna The FM detachable and extendable antenna provides exibility and range when adjusting the
FM reception.
19 AM Antenna The AM detachable antenna provides exibility and range when adjusting the AM reception.
20 Fuse (T1.6L/250V Fuse) If this fuse is blown, unplug the unit and replace it with an equivalent type.
21 AUX In Use the AUX In port to connect external audio source to the unit.
22 Wall Mount After removing the table top stand, use the Wall Mount when attaching the player to a wall.
• To ensure a reliable and sturdy installation, please consult a professional installer before mounting the unit
to a wall.
23 Wall Mount Brackets Screw the Wall Mount Brackets into a wall stud before hanging the unit onto the
brackets.
24 AC Cord (120V ~ 60 Hz) The attached AC Cord provides power to the player.
25 Table Stand Use the Table Stand when placing the player on an entertainment center, table, or desk.
